I said it before and I'll say it again:

Carolina led the league last year with a +20 takeaway ratio.
This year?  They are third worst at -8.
The Panthers are being slapped back down to reality by the law of averages.  Teams that rely on takeaway advantage to win tend to implode when the balls stop bouncing their way.

(Interestingly, DAL was worst in the league last year but is t-6th in 2016.)
